Quick Summary

Eaton Crouse-Hinds Roughneck E1049-51 plug is a high-amperage power connector for heavy-duty industrial distribution. Facilities often struggle with reliable terminations for large cables that withstand outdoor exposure and downtime. This solution is certified for NEC/CEC compliance and rated NEMA 3, offering up to 1000 Vac/dc and 898 A continuous capacity for robust performance in ordinary locations. With copper contacts and a rubber housing, it delivers dependable termination and long service life, while hex crimp or solder options support flexible field installation. FAQs

The E1049-51 is designed for loose-fit and field-terminated scenarios using hexagon crimp or solder connections. It supports 535 kcmil cables with copper contacts inside a rubber housing and is suitable for ordinary/non-hazardous locations per NEC/CEC. For installation steps, refer to IF 1777/IF 1778 instruction sheets and the Roughneck literature.
Key specs include a voltage rating of 1000 Vac/dc, amperage up to 898 A continuous, and compatibility with 535 kcmil cables. The connector is female and uses hex crimp or solder termination. These ratings enable reliable service for large-diameter feeders in industrial power distribution.
Yes. The E1049-51 adheres to NEC/CEC standards and carries a NEMA Rating of 3. It is classified for Ordinary/Non-Hazardous Locations, making it suitable for general industrial environments without explosion-proof requirements.
